400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el中 i 是什么意思

作者:路由通
|
98人看过
发布时间:2025-11-20 04:52:18
标签:
在表格处理软件中,字母"i"具有多重含义和应用场景。它既可作为迭代计算的计数器,又能作为复杂公式中的关键参数,甚至在某些函数中承担特定功能标识。本文通过十二个典型应用场景,深入解析"i"在数据统计分析、循环引用计算、数组公式构建以及可视化编程等功能模块中的核心作用,并结合实际案例演示其操作逻辑和实用技巧,帮助用户全面掌握这一看似简单却功能强大的工具符号。
excel中 i 是什么意思

       理解基础概念中的标识作用

       在表格处理环境中,字母"i"最常见的作用是作为迭代计算的计数器变量。当用户启用迭代计算功能时,系统允许公式循环引用自身单元格,此时"i"通常代表当前迭代次数。例如在计算累计增长率时,可以设置公式为"=前值(1+增长率)^i",通过调整最大迭代次数来控计算精度。这种用法常见于财务建模和工程计算领域,需要配合文件选项中的公式设置进行调整。

       数据透视表中的字段标识

       在创建数据透视表时,"i"可能作为计算字段的临时变量。比如添加自定义计算字段时,若使用"=SUM(字段1)/i"这样的表达式,这里的"i"可以代表总行数或特定计数。实际操作中,用户可以通过右键菜单的"计算字段"选项,输入包含"i"的表达式来创建动态计算逻辑。这种方法特别适用于需要动态参照总体数据规模的百分比计算场景。

       数组公式中的索引参数

       高级用户在使用数组公式时,经常用"i"作为元素索引标识符。例如需要提取二维数组中特定对角线元素时,可以构造"=INDEX(数据区域,ROW(A1),ROW(A1))"这样的公式,其中ROW函数生成的序列就相当于"i"的作用。更复杂的应用场景包括结合SMALL函数和IF函数进行条件筛选时,"i"作为位置参数控制返回结果的顺序。

       宏编程中的循环变量

       在VBA(可视化基本应用程序)编程环境中,"i"作为循环计数器的使用更为普遍。例如编写批量处理单元格的宏时,典型代码结构为:"For i = 1 To 10 Cells(i,1).Value = i2 Next i"。这种用法源自传统编程习惯,通过让"i"遍历指定范围来实现自动化操作。在实际应用中,用户还可以嵌套多层循环,使用i、j、k等变量区分不同维度的循环层次。

       数学函数中的特定参数

       某些专业函数库中,"i"可能代表虚数单位。虽然日常办公中较少使用,但在工程计算加载项中,处理复数运算时会遇到类似"=COMPLEX(3,4)"的函数,其中第二个参数4即虚部系数,相当于数学表达式中的"4i"。用户可以通过"分析工具库"加载宏启用这些专业函数,用于电气工程或物理学的复数计算需求。

       条件格式中的动态参照

       设置条件格式规则时,"i"可隐含表示当前行号。例如要隔行添加背景色,可以使用公式"=MOD(ROW(),2)=0",这里的ROW()函数返回值就承担了"i"的角色。更高级的应用是在创建动态数据条时,通过"=CELL("row")"获取当前行号作为条件格式的参照基准,实现随着数据排序变化而自动调整的可视化效果。

       图表制作中的序列生成

       制作动态图表时,经常需要生成等间隔的序列值作为横坐标。此时可以通过"=起始值+(i-1)步长"的公式结构快速生成等差数列,其中"i"用ROW(A1)代替。例如创建正弦曲线图时,在A列输入"=0+(ROW(A1)-1)0.1"并向下填充,即可生成0,0.1,0.2...的序列,B列则计算SIN(A1)得到对应函数值。

       查找函数中的位置偏移

       在使用VLOOKUP(垂直查找)或HLOOKUP(水平查找)函数时,第三个参数可以视为"i"的变体应用。例如"=VLOOKUP(查找值,数据区域,3,FALSE)"中的数字3,本质上是指定返回数据区域中第i列的值。进阶用法是将这个参数改为MATCH函数动态获取,实现根据标题名称自动确定列位置的智能查找公式。

       文本处理中的模式匹配

       处理包含序列编号的文本字符串时,"i"常作为提取模式中的位置标识。比如从"Item-001"格式的文字中提取数字编号,可使用"=MID(A1,FIND("-",A1)+1,3)",其中的起始位置参数FIND("-",A1)+1就相当于确定了数字段开始的位置i。更复杂的文本分析还可以结合LEN和SUBSTITUTE函数计算特定字符出现的位置序列。

       随机数生成中的种子值

       在模拟分析和蒙特卡洛方法中,经常需要生成可重复的随机数序列。此时可以将"i"作为RAND函数的种子参数,通过"=RAND()(最大值-最小值)+最小值"的公式结构,配合i值的变化生成可控随机序列。专业用户还会使用数据分析工具库中的随机数生成器,设置不同的分布类型和参数来实现更复杂的模拟需求。

       日期计算中的周期索引

       处理周期性日期数据时,"i"可表示第i个周期单位。例如计算未来12个月的同日日期,可以使用"=EDATE(起始日期,ROW(A1))"公式,其中ROW(A1)产生的序列就是i的取值。同样方法适用于工作日计算(NETWORKDAYS函数)、季度末日期确定等场景,通过改变i值快速生成日期序列。

       高级筛选中的条件构建

       设置高级筛选条件区域时,"i"隐含表示条件之间的逻辑关系。例如要筛选满足多个条件中任意一个的记录,可以将条件横向排列,这相当于"条件1 OR 条件2"的逻辑,其中每个条件的位置可视为i。相反,纵向排列条件则表示"条件1 AND 条件2"的关系,这种用法在复杂数据筛选中尤为实用。

       功率查询中的行上下文

       在Power Query(功率查询)工具中处理数据转换时,"i"的概念体现为行上下文标识。添加自定义列时使用的each_表达式,系统会自动生成代表当前行的临时变量(通常显示为下划线)。例如要提取文件名中的序号,可以编写"= Text.Remove([文件名],"A".."Z","a".."z")",这里的计算会针对每一行(即每个i值)分别执行。

       动态数组中的溢出引用

       新版表格软件推出的动态数组功能中,"i"隐式存在于溢出范围引用机制。当输入"=SORT(区域)"这样的公式时,结果会自动填充到相邻单元格,形成动态数组。要引用这个数组中的第i个元素,可以使用INDEX函数配合SEQUENCE函数生成索引序列,实现类似传统编程中数组遍历的效果。

       规划求解中的约束计数

       使用规划求解工具进行优化计算时,"i"常作为约束条件的序号标识。例如在资源分配问题中,每个约束条件对应一个i值,表示第i种资源的限制条件。通过规划求解参数对话框,用户可以依次添加多个约束,系统内部会建立约束条件集合,并通过改变i值遍历检查所有约束满足情况。

       三维引用中的工作表索引

       在跨工作表计算时,"i"可以表示工作表在三维引用中的位置序号。例如"=SUM(Sheet1:Sheet3!A1)"这样的公式,实际上是对第1到第3个工作表的A1单元格求和,其中的工作表顺序就构成了隐式的i序列。用户可以通过定义名称创建更灵活的三维引用,实现动态工作表范围的汇总计算。

       错误处理中的嵌套层级

       构建复杂公式时,经常需要多层错误处理。此时"i"可概念化表示IFERROR函数的嵌套深度。例如"=IFERROR(公式1,IFERROR(公式2,IFERROR(公式3,"最终备选值")))"这样的结构,相当于尝试第i种计算方法直到成功。这种方法在数据清洗和跨系统数据对接时特别有用,可以逐步尝试多种解析方案。

       通过以上多个维度的解析,我们可以看到表格软件中"i"这个符号虽然简单,却在不同场景下承载着丰富的功能含义。从基础计算到高级编程,从数据处理到可视化分析,理解并熟练运用"i"的各种应用模式,将显著提升数据处理的效率与精度。建议用户根据实际工作需求,选择最适合的应用场景进行深入实践。

相关文章
excel打印为什么只有序号
本文深入解析Excel打印只显示序号的12个常见原因,涵盖打印区域设置、隐藏行列、页面布局、打印机驱动等关键因素,并提供详细的排查解决方案,帮助用户彻底解决打印异常问题。
2025-11-20 04:51:44
261人看过
excel中表格颜色用什么表示
本文深度解析表格颜色的表示方法,涵盖十六进制代码、RGB数值、主题色索引等8大核心体系。通过财务数据标记、项目进度管理等16个实用案例,详解如何精准选择与搭配颜色,并揭示条件格式中颜色规则的底层逻辑,帮助用户掌握专业级表格色彩应用技巧。
2025-11-20 04:51:41
57人看过
为什么word一直闪动
当微软文字处理软件(Microsoft Word)界面频繁闪烁时,往往由软件冲突、硬件加速设置或文件损坏等多重因素导致。本文通过十二个核心维度系统剖析闪烁成因,结合操作案例与官方解决方案,帮助用户精准定位问题。从图形驱动程序更新到宏病毒查杀,从事务模式关闭到加载项管理,层层递进提供实操性修复路径,彻底终结屏幕闪烁困扰。
2025-11-20 04:51:22
394人看过
有什么好word文档的结尾
一份出色的文档结尾如同画龙点睛,能提升整体专业度。本文系统梳理十二种实用结尾策略,涵盖总结归纳、行动号召、问题反思等类型,结合商业报告、学术论文等真实场景案例,详解如何通过结尾强化文档逻辑性与感染力,让每个文档都能形成完整闭环。
2025-11-20 04:51:03
111人看过
word为什么有些字符间距大
在日常使用文字处理软件时,许多用户会遇到字符间距异常增大的情况,这不仅影响文档美观,更干扰阅读连贯性。字符间距问题通常源于字体特性、格式设置、排版功能等多重因素相互作用。本文将系统解析十二个导致字符间距变大的核心原因,通过具体案例演示解决方案,帮助用户从根本上掌握字符间距的控制技巧,提升文档排版的专业性。
2025-11-20 04:51:00
219人看过
华为为什么打不开word文件
华为设备无法打开Word文档可能由多种因素导致,包括系统兼容性冲突、软件版本不匹配、权限设置限制以及文件本身损坏等。本文将从技术层面深入分析十二个核心原因,并提供实用解决方案,帮助用户快速恢复文档访问能力。
2025-11-20 04:50:57
78人看过